What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Full Stack Int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Full Stack Intern, you need foundational knowledge of front-end and back-end development, proficiency in programming languages like JavaScript, HTML/CSS, and at least one backend language, often demonstrated through coursework or projects. Familiarity with frameworks like React or Angular, databases such as MySQL or MongoDB, and version control systems like Git is typically expected. Strong problem-solving skills, eagerness to learn, and effective communication help interns excel in team-based, fast-paced environments. These skills and qualities are crucial for adapting to diverse tasks and contributing meaningfully to complex software projects.

What types of projects and technologies can I expect to work with during a Full Stack Internship?

As a Full Stack Intern, you'll typically be involved in both front-end and back-end development tasks, often contributing to real-world projects such as website features, web applications, or internal tools. You can expect to work with modern frameworks like React or Angular for the front end and Node.js, Python, or Java for the back end, along with databases like MongoDB or PostgreSQL. Interns often collaborate closely with senior developers and participate in code reviews, agile sprints, and team meetings, gaining practical experience across the software development lifecycle. This hands-on exposure is designed to develop your technical skills and prepare you for a future full-time role.

What is a Full Stack Internship?

A Full Stack Internship is a temporary position designed for students or recent graduates to gain practical experience working on both front-end and back-end aspects of web development. Interns typically work under the guidance of experienced developers, contributing to real-world projects using a variety of programming languages and frameworks. The role provides exposure to the entire development lifecycle, from designing user interfaces to managing databases and server-side logic. This hands-on experience helps interns build a strong foundation for a career as a full stack developer.

Quantcast is the advertising platform brands like IKEA, Microsoft, and United Airlines use to run ads that drive measurable business outcomes - a purchase, a sign-up, a booking. Advertisers want to know where and how every dollar was spent, and how that contributes to the outcome. The Campaign Success team builds the products advertisers open every morning to see what their ads drove and decide where to push budget next - and we're re-imagining that experience from the ground up using agentic engineering and Quantcast's unique data.
We are hiring a new grad or early-career engineer to ship features that customers use directly. You'll be paired with a senior engineer as your mentor through onboarding and beyond, own pieces of the product, and operate the systems you build.
What you'll do:
  • Build customer-facing features that surface insights about ad campaigns - full stack: React and TypeScript frontend, Java/Python backend, database, with testing, monitoring, docs, and operational ownership.
  • Hands-on exploration of how AI agents fit into our product and our customers' workflows - what unlocks real value, what's noise, what we should ship next.
  • Participation in our engineering rituals - system design discussions, Code reviews, on-call, the operational habits that keep a team shipping reliably.
  • Cross-functional work with Product Managers and Designers - you'll be in the room when we decide what to build and why, not just be handed a spec to implement.

Who you are:
  • New grad or up to 1 year of experience.
  • You must be work-authorized in the United States without the need for current or future employer sponsorship. We are not currently able to engage candidates on OPT.
  • You've built at least one substantive project - a side project, a class project, an internship deliverable, an open-source contribution. You can talk through the trade-offs you made and what you'd do differently. Bonus if real people used it, and if you built it with AI tools.
  • Comfortable in at least one of TypeScript, Java, or Python, and willing to dive into the others. We don't expect mastery on day one.
  • Solid CS fundamentals - algorithms, data structures, object-oriented design. You're curious about what your code does beyond your function - across services, in the database, on the wire.
  • You want to understand who'll use what you build, and ask "should we build this?" as much as "can we build this?"
  • You aim to write clearly about technical things - it's hard, but it's half of engineering, and we'll help you grow into it.
